(Las Vegas) The NBA has unveiled details for the inaugural NBA Cup, which will take place during the regular season and will have approximately $18 million in prize money.

The tournament will begin in November and conclude with the presentation of the final on December 9 in Las Vegas. Tournament games will count towards the regular season standings, but not the final.

Commissioner Adam Silver had been trying to set up this project for several years, offering teams a trophy to win during the season.

Members of the winning team will each receive $500,000 and members of the runner-up team $200,000. Players from teams eliminated in the Semi-Finals will each receive $100,000 and players from teams eliminated in the Quarter-Finals, $50,000.

Tournament matches will begin on November 3 and will mostly be played on Tuesdays and Fridays. The four aces will be contested in Las Vegas.

The teams were separated into six groups of five teams. They will play a match against each other member of their group and the six winners will advance to the quarter-finals, along with the two best teams that finished second in their group.

The Toronto Raptors have been placed in Group C East, along with the Boston Celtics, Brooklyn Nets, Chicago Bulls and Orlando Magic.
